public abstract class DoubleExpressionPredicate extends Object implements FilterExpression
| Modifier and Type | Class and Description |
|---|---|
static class |
DoubleExpressionPredicate.And
Indicates
FilterExpression.Operator.AND operator expression:
storagePlugin = 'dfs' and workspace = 'tmp'. |
static class |
DoubleExpressionPredicate.Or
Indicates
FilterExpression.Operator.OR operator expression:
storagePlugin = 'dfs' or storagePlugin = 's3'. |
FilterExpression.Operator, FilterExpression.Visitor<T>| Modifier | Constructor and Description |
|---|---|
protected |
DoubleExpressionPredicate(FilterExpression right,
FilterExpression.Operator operator,
FilterExpression left) |
| Modifier and Type | Method and Description |
|---|---|
FilterExpression |
left() |
FilterExpression.Operator |
operator() |
FilterExpression |
right() |
String |
toString() |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itaccept, and, and, equal, greaterThan, greaterThanOrEqual, in, in, isNotNull, isNull, lessThan, lessThanOrEqual, not, notEqual, notIn, notIn, orprotected DoubleExpressionPredicate(FilterExpression right, FilterExpression.Operator operator, FilterExpression left)
public FilterExpression right()
public FilterExpression left()
public FilterExpression.Operator operator()
operator in interface FilterExpressionCopyright © 2021 The Apache Software Foundation. All rights reserved.